An Anchorage Police officer was wounded earlier today during a shootout at a local motel.
APD spokesman Lt. Dave Parker said the shooting took place at the Merrill Field Inn. The motel was evacuated and Fifth Avenue, one of the main traffic arteries into the city, was shut down for about two hours. Parker says it all began when two APD officers were investigating a burglary.
The injured officer and the two people in the motel room were taken to safety, and a SWAT team was called in to negotiate with the shooter, whom, Parker says, police believe was wounded during the return gunfire. The suspect, as yet un-named, surrendered to police officers at about 1:30 this afternoon.
